Re: Starting KDE from gdm?



Dne po 16. června 2003 07:12 Albert Schueller napsal(a):
> I just installed kde 3.1.2 from download.kde.org on top of a pretty
> stock woody distro.  I didn't install kdm.  The problem is that kde
> isn't offered as a login session under gdm.  I don't know much about
> configuring gdm, but there is a script under /etc/gdm/Sessions called
> "KDE" that looks like it ought to start kde.  However, gdm seems to be
> ignoring that.

Is this real file or symlink?
ls -l /etc/gdm/Sessions
gdm have problem with symlinks - you need copy real file here.
